What is the Authorization to Discuss and Disclose Pension Information?
The Authorization to Discuss and Disclose Pension Information is a crucial form for members of the CAAT Pension Plan. It allows members to authorize specific representatives to engage in discussions related to their pension information. This authorization ensures that members can effectively manage their pension queries through trusted individuals.
Key to this process is the importance of signatures. Both the member and a witness must sign the authorization for it to be valid, safeguarding the interests of all parties involved.

Who Needs the Authorization to Discuss and Disclose Pension Information?
Identifying the right individuals who need this authorization is vital for its effective use. Members of the CAAT Pension Plan are typically the ones who will complete this form. Representatives may include family members, financial advisors, or legal representatives who will act on the member's behalf.
There are specific scenarios when a representative may be necessary, such as when the member is unavailable or incapacitated. In these cases, having a witness sign the form adds an extra layer of security and validity.

Who is eligible to use this form?
Any member of the CAAT Pension Plan can use this form to authorize someone else to discuss or obtain their pension information. Representatives may include family members or legal representatives.
Is there a deadline for submitting this form?
There is generally no specific deadline for submitting the Authorization to Discuss and Disclose Pension Information. However, it is advisable to submit it before any discussions regarding your pension take place.
How do I submit the completed form?
Once the form is completed, you can submit it electronically through pdfFiller. Alternatively, you may need to print it, sign it, and mail it to the appropriate pension plan office.
What documents do I need to accompany this form?
Usually, this form does not require additional documents. However, it's recommended to have valid identification for both you and your representative when submitting the form.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all required fields are completed, particularly names and signatures. Missing or incorrect information can delay the process. Double-check the witness's signature to confirm validation.
Are there any fees associated with this form?
Typically, there are no fees for submitting the Authorization to Discuss and Disclose Pension Information. However, check with the CAAT Pension Plan for any updates or specific circumstances.
How long does it take for this authorization to be processed?
Processing times can vary. Generally, allow a few business days after submission for the authorization to be recognized. For urgent matters, contact the CAAT Pension Plan directly.
